Flavin Ventures Experience
Below is a summary of the relevant transactions in which we have played a leading role:
- Successfully interfaced with and finalized a special protocol assessment (SPA) with the FDA for novel oral antibiotic, Restanza™ (cethromycin), for treatment of community acquired bacterial pneumonia (CABP).
- Met with FDA in over a dozen face-to-face meetings to establish regulatory pathway in CABP and biodefense indications including anthrax, plague tularemia and Burkholderia pseudomallei
- Successfully lobbied BARDA to adjust Broad Agency Announcement rules to reflect FDA requirements, including clinical development of antibiotics for commercial indications to support biodefense approval.
- Led the submission of New Drug Application (NDA) to FDA for Restanza.
- Negotiated a development and commercialization agreement for the Asia Pacific region with Wyeth for Restanza.
- Negotiated Standby Equity Distribution Agreement and raised $15 million through stock sales for ADLS.
- Secured $4 Million award with the DTRA for biodefense contract to develop Restanza in plague, tularemia and Burkholderia pseudomallei
- Completed $35 Million IPO for ADLS.
- Negotiated with the State of Illinois Department of Economic Opportunity for $500,000 grant for ADLS.
- Led the negotiation for license to acquire a Phase 3 antibiotic, Restanza, from Abbott Laboratories.
- Completed sale of MediChem Life Sciences (MCLS) to DeCODE Genetics for $84 Million.
- Completed $54 Million IPO of MCLS.
- Managed MCLS acquisition and integration of two biotechnology companies, ThermoGen and Emerald BioStructures.
- Formed Sarawak MediChem Pharmaceuticals (SMP) a joint venture with the Government of Sarawak, Malaysia and recruited $20 million investment from the Sarawak Government to develop calanolide A, a natural product found in the Malaysian rainforest as a treatment for HIV/AIDS.
- Completed a $35 Million private equity and debt financing at MCLS.
- Founded MCLS as medicinal chemistry contract research organization.
- Completed two Private Investments in a Public Equity (PIPEs) $36 Million and $20 Million each, for ADLS.
- Secured over $6 million in research and development contracts with NIAID to develop Restanza as a broad spectrum medical countermeasure for biodefense.
